In 2021-2022, 116,994 people earned their degree in communication & journalism, making the major the 11th most popular in the United States. In , communication & journalism graduates who were awarded their degree in , earned an average of $34,306 and had an average of $24,240 in loans still to pay off.

Across Florida, there were 7,055 communication & journalism graduates with average earnings and debt of $33,287 and $21,926 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 732 communication & journalism graduates with average earnings and debt of $55,663 and $45,470 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Communication & Journalism Major in Florida” ranking looked at 13 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in communication & journalism. That schools that top this list have a program in communication & journalism in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.
